Car Idles At About 2500 When It Starts
I have an b16 head on a gsr block and it is in a 94 civic hatch cx with the cx wiring harness. When I turn my car on it revs up to about 2500-3000 and stays there for a few minutes but then eventually it drops to around 1000. I think this problem has something to do with the cx harness and the b series iacv but I wasn't able to find a definitive answer. Can someone please help me out?

Re: Car Idles At About 2500 When It Starts (msmithgsr2131)
2500-3000 is a bit excessive tho for cold idle..it should be 1500ish ...clean ur IACV? inside the intake manifold? Butterfly of TB not geting stuck? loosen ur TB cable? TPS sensor set to right voltage?
